One way to model an option with dividends in the binomial framework is for the stock price minus the present value of the dividends to grow by the up and down factors.


Definitions:

Competition Act

Canadian federal law aimed at preventing anti-competitive practices in the marketplace.

Exempt Activities

Actions or operations that are not subject to certain regulations, restrictions, or legal requirements, usually due to their nature or context.

Resale Price Maintenance

A practice where manufacturers or suppliers dictate the minimum price at which retailers can sell their products, often scrutinized under competition laws.

Refusal to Supply

An act whereby a business decides not to sell or provide goods or services to another business or individual.
